Well, only one thing you can do now, put a Goerend built 47RH behind the old Cummins.
As for the oil, check the turbo outlet first, should be wet with oil if its leaving oil down the bed. Then I would take the turbo off the manifold and look in both exhaust outlets, if they're dry then its the turbo, if there's oil in there, obliviously its coming from the engine.
